A Maximum Likelihood Location Estimator For Non-Line Of Sight Geolocation Of Radio Emitters

摘要
We propose a novel Maximum Likelihood (ML) location estimator for use in dense urban environments that uniquely exploits the scattering environment geometry in order to mitigate the need for Line of Sight (LOS) paths. The estimator is derived and a method for calculating a numerical approximation is presented. A simple scattering model is used to assess the performance of the algorithm. Within a 400 m by 400 m search area a mean estimation error of 45 m is achieved, however, this is dependent on the assumed parameters of the simulated propagation environment.
